An AI agent marketplace is a store where you discover, buy, and deploy ready-made AI agents instead of building them from scratch. Agentmarketplace is the app store for AI agents: you browse vetted, security-scanned agents by category and use case, deploy the one you want in a single click onto your own stack, and run it on any model. Creators publish and monetize their agents, and buyers avoid lock-in because agents run on your tools, not trapped inside one platform.

It means agents are not trapped inside our platform or tied to one model vendor. Agents you deploy run on your own stack, connect to the tools you already use, and run on whatever model you choose. You can change the model, export your setup, or remove an agent at any time. We do not own your runtime, so you are never locked in.

Agents connect to the tools you already use, including Slack, HubSpot, Salesforce, Notion, Stripe, Gmail, GitHub, Shopify, Zendesk, Google Calendar, and Zapier, among others. Each agent lists the integrations it needs, and you grant access with scoped, revocable permissions when you deploy it.

Creators publish their agent to the marketplace, set a price, and earn about 80% of every sale (roughly a 20% marketplace fee, the industry norm). Agentmarketplace handles discovery, billing, deployment, and trust signals like review and security scanning, so creators focus on building a great agent and get paid when teams deploy it.
